当前位置:首页 > 数控加工中心 > 正文

数控加工自动反转程序怎么设置(数控编程反转代码)

数控加工自动反转程序设置是数控编程中的一个重要环节,它涉及到零件的加工精度和效率。以下将从专业角度详细阐述数控加工自动反转程序设置的方法,并通过案例进行分析。

一、数控加工自动反转程序设置概述

数控加工自动反转程序设置是指在数控编程过程中,通过对零件加工路径的规划,使刀具在加工过程中实现自动反转,以达到提高加工效率、降低加工成本的目的。自动反转程序设置主要包括以下步骤:

1. 分析零件加工工艺,确定加工路径。

2. 根据加工路径,编写反转代码。

3. 将反转代码嵌入数控程序中。

4. 验证反转程序的正确性。

二、数控加工自动反转程序设置方法

1. 分析零件加工工艺,确定加工路径

在设置自动反转程序之前,首先要分析零件的加工工艺,确定加工路径。这包括分析零件的结构、尺寸、加工要求等,以便确定刀具的加工顺序和路径。

2. 编写反转代码

反转代码是数控编程中实现自动反转的关键。以下是一些常见的反转代码:

(1)G64:顺时针反转

G64 X100.0 Y100.0 Z100.0 F100.0;

(2)G65:逆时针反转

G65 X100.0 Y100.0 Z100.0 F100.0;

(3)G66:自动反转

数控加工自动反转程序怎么设置(数控编程反转代码)

G66 X100.0 Y100.0 Z100.0 F100.0;

3. 将反转代码嵌入数控程序中

将编写好的反转代码嵌入数控程序中,确保刀具在加工过程中按照既定路径进行自动反转。

4. 验证反转程序的正确性

在设置自动反转程序后,需要对程序进行验证,确保反转路径的正确性和加工精度。

三、案例分析与讨论

1. 案例一:加工圆孔

零件要求:加工一个直径为φ50mm的圆孔,深度为20mm。

分析:在加工圆孔时,刀具需要从孔的底部开始加工,然后向上移动,实现顺时针反转。

反转代码:

G64 X0 Y0 Z-20.0 F100.0;

G0 X25.0 Y0;

G64 X25.0 Y0 Z-20.0 F100.0;

2. 案例二:加工方孔

零件要求:加工一个边长为30mm的方孔,深度为20mm。

分析:在加工方孔时,刀具需要从方孔的底部开始加工,然后向两侧移动,实现逆时针反转。

反转代码:

G65 X0 Y0 Z-20.0 F100.0;

G0 X15.0 Y15.0;

G65 X15.0 Y15.0 Z-20.0 F100.0;

3. 案例三:加工异形孔

零件要求:加工一个异形孔,如图所示。

分析:在加工异形孔时,刀具需要按照既定路径进行加工,实现自动反转。

反转代码:

G66 X0 Y0 Z-20.0 F100.0;

G0 X25.0 Y20.0;

G66 X25.0 Y20.0 Z-20.0 F100.0;

4. 案例四:加工槽口

零件要求:加工一个宽度为10mm,深度为30mm的槽口。

分析:在加工槽口时,刀具需要从槽口的一端开始加工,然后向另一端移动,实现顺时针反转。

反转代码:

G64 X0 Y0 Z-30.0 F100.0;

G0 X50.0 Y0;

G64 X50.0 Y0 Z-30.0 F100.0;

5. 案例五:加工螺纹

零件要求:加工一个外径为φ20mm,螺距为1.5mm的螺纹。

分析:在加工螺纹时,刀具需要按照既定路径进行加工,实现自动反转。

反转代码:

G66 X0 Y0 Z-20.0 F100.0;

G0 X25.0 Y0;

G66 X25.0 Y0 Z-20.0 F100.0;

四、常见问题问答

1. 问题:什么是数控加工自动反转程序?

回答:数控加工自动反转程序是指在数控编程过程中,通过编写反转代码,使刀具在加工过程中实现自动反转,以提高加工效率和精度。

2. 问题:自动反转程序设置有哪些步骤?

回答:自动反转程序设置包括分析零件加工工艺、编写反转代码、将反转代码嵌入数控程序中、验证反转程序的正确性。

3. 问题:如何编写反转代码?

回答:编写反转代码需要根据零件的加工工艺和路径,选择合适的反转代码,如G64、G65、G66等。

4. 问题:如何验证反转程序的正确性?

数控加工自动反转程序怎么设置(数控编程反转代码)

回答:验证反转程序的正确性可以通过模拟加工、实际加工或对比分析等方法进行。

5. 问题:自动反转程序设置有哪些注意事项?

数控加工自动反转程序怎么设置(数控编程反转代码)

回答:自动反转程序设置时,需要注意以下几点:确保反转路径的正确性、加工精度和效率、避免刀具碰撞等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。